Technical Specifications

Parameter NameValue
TypeParameter
Mount Surface Mount
Mounting Type Surface Mount
Package / Case SOT-23-6
Number of Pins 6
Operating Temperature-40°C~85°C TA
PackagingTape & Reel (TR)
Published 2011
JESD-609 Code e3
Pbfree Code yes
Part StatusObsolete
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 6
ECCN Code EAR99
Type Battery Backup Circuit
Terminal Finish Matte Tin (Sn)
Subcategory Power Management Circuits
Max Power Dissipation696mW
Technology BICMOS
Terminal Position DUAL
Terminal FormGUL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 2.38V
Terminal Pitch0.95mm
Base Part Number MAX6361
Output Open Drain or Open Collector
Pin Count6
Power Supplies2.5/5V
Number of Channels 1
Max Supply Voltage5.5V
Min Supply Voltage0V
Operating Supply Current 15μA
Adjustable Threshold NO
Watchdog TimerNo
Reset Active High
Voltage - Threshold 4.63V
Number of Voltages Monitored1
Reset Timeout 150ms Minimum
Supply Current-Max (Isup) 0.05mA
Min Reset Threshold Voltage 4.5V
Max Reset Threshold Voltage 4.75V
Undervoltage Threshold4.5V
Overvoltage Threshold4.75V
Length 2.9mm
RoHS StatusROHS3 Compliant
Lead Free Lead Free
